Solitary confinement is a form of imprisonment distinguished by living in single cells with little or no meaningful contact to other inmates, strict measures to control contraband, and the use of additional security measures and equipment. It is specifically designed for disruptive inmates who are security risks to other inmates, the prison. As well as bumblebees and honey bees that live socially there are over 240 species of wild bees in the uk that are called solitary bees because they make individual nest cells for their larvae. In the 1780s and 1790s, prominent philadelphia intellectuals, including benjamin rush and pennsylvania supreme court justice william bradford, championed solitude as a sanction for crime. Solitary confinement is more commonly referred to as restrictive housing, segregated housing and special housing units shu by most departments of correction.
